What Is Calisthenics – Really?

The word comes from Ancient Greek:

  • Kallos – beauty

  • Sthenos – strength

At CaliUnity, we keep that spirit alive.
Calisthenics = strength + control + flow.

It blends bodyweight movements, mobility, and skill work into something that builds:

  • Muscle

  • Joint stability

  • Functional movement

  • And real confidence – at any age

No machines. No ego. No one-size-fits-all program.

Real Tip: Build Your Base, Then Build Everything Else

Start where you are.
Nail the basics: push-ups, rows, squats, core holds.
From there, your body will unlock more – strength, mobility, energy, control.

And if you're working with injuries or stiffness? Even better.
Calisthenics is one of the safest, most adaptable ways to train. It helps you:

  • Strengthen connective tissues

  • Increase end-range mobility

  • Improve mind-muscle connection

  • Prevent injury while building muscle
